大陆岩石圈与软流圈之间的耦合关系─—大陆动力学研究的突破口

摘    要:板块构造学说解释了全球构造的许多现象,但尚未满意地解释大陆构造中的一些问题,例如陆内造山带的形成、造山带和盆地形成的复杂历史和旋回性问题、大陆构造圈的不均一性等。新近提出的一些构造模式,都不约而同地指出了软流圈在大陆构造发展中的重要作用,但尚未成功解决软流圈运动的驱动力问题。本文认为,大陆岩石圈与软流圈之间相互作用关系的深入研究,是阐明大陆动力学过程的关键之一。此外,本文还对“软流体振荡作用”工作假说作了初步讨论。

COUPLING BETWEEN CONTINENTAL LITHOSPHERE AND ASTHENOSPHERE:A BREAKTHROUGH POINT IN CONTINENTAL DYNAMICAL STUDY
Abstract:In spite of great popularity of plate tectonics and its successful application in explain-ing some global tectonic phenomena,the concept contains certain shortcomings and contradic-tions. Many continental tectonic problems,such as formation of intracontinental mountains,complex history and cyclicity of orogenic zone and basin development , and inhomogeneity ofcontinental tectonosphere,cannot satisfactorily solved in terms of this concept.In terms of sometectonic hypotheses proposed in recent years have been raised the importance of asthenosphereor asthenoliths in the tectonic activity as if by previous agreement,but with these hypothesescannot successfully solved the driving force problem of asthenolith movement. The present pa-per suggests that a profound study of the interacting relationship between continental litho-sphere and asthenosphere is one of the keys to understanding continental dynamics. In this pa-per,a new working hypothesis,“asthenolith vibration”concept is discussed.
